[RESOLVED] Web Mail
Last night I could not open either of my web mail accounts to check for emails. Google search had me to go to tools>internet options>Advanced and in the Security section, I had to check mark the 2 SSL and 3 TSL options. Then my web mail accounts could be opened. I do not recall ever marking those before. Perhaps, and I would not know, they were previously checked but 'something' removed the check marks. I had no malware reported per Malwarebytes. buf--Hard to tell. Have you changed any settings in IE Tools|Internet Options|Content tab lately?
Clear SSL Slate
To clear the SSL slate:
1. Select "Tools" on your menu bar and open your "Internet Options".
2. Go for the "Content" tab and select "Certificates".
3. Click "Clear SSL Slate" and "OK".
4. You should receive a message to confirm that it has been cleared.
